Abstract :
CO2 injection has been used for many years and it is accepted as a beneficial tertiary recovery method. However, there are very limited studies of liquid CO2 injection process and its effect on reservoir properties. The objective of this research is to investigate the effects of liquid CO2 injection on temperature distribution, fluid properties and oil recovery in a high temperature reservoir. A thermal compositional model is used to simulate the behavior of the reservoir in terms of viscosity, front movement and temperature. The main results of the study show that the temperature of the reservoir is affected by injection temperature and its rate; also, the effect of low temperature on viscosity cannot eliminate viscosity reduction by CO2. The recovery is doubled (12.81% increase) and mainly is due to liquid CO2 viscosity reduction by 6 times.
